We discuss duality in N=1 SUSY gauge theories in Seibeg's conformal window, 3N(c)/2<N-f<3N(c). The 't Hooft consistency conditions, the basic tool for establishing the infrared duality, are considered taking into account higher order alpha corrections. The conserved (anomaly-free) R current is built to all orders in alpha. Although this current contains all orders in alpha the 't Hooft consistency conditions for this current are shown to be one loop. This observation thus justifies Seiberg's matching procedure. We also briefly discuss the inequivalence of the ''electric'' and ''magnetic'' theories at short distances.
